French Car Festival
20 October 2013 @ 9:00 am - 4:00 pm
This venue for this year’s French Car Festival is Seaworks Maritime Precinct at 82 Nelson Place, Williamstown, from 9.30am to 3pm. Enter via Ann Street. Entry is $10 per car, with passengers. Pedestrians will pay a gold coin donation.
As there are no plans to have separate areas for different makes, it would be great to arrive in a group. So from 9am we will form a convoy at Donald McLean Reserve, The Avenue, Spotswood (Melway 41, K12), leaving at 9.15am. This reserve is just off the West Gate Freeway.
The French Car Festival venue offers raffles, live music, cooking demonstrations, wine tasting food and drink stalls, an on-site tavern, merchandise tents, seaplane flights and a great outlook.
Major prizes will be presented by the honorary consul-general for France, Mrs Myriam Boisbouvier-Wylie and Fletch from Classic Restos will be there to document the event.
There will be special awards for “barn find” and “restoration in progress”.
The event will also be the PCCV concours, so make sure your Pug is looking its best.
For those whose vehicles are so precious that they need to be under cover, there will be parking sport than can be reserved. And the cars can be left there on the afternoon of the day before the big event, by arrangement with the organisers.
This year’s French Car Festival is organised by the Renault Car Club of Victoria.
